Dr. Steven Wong
Doctor of Acupuncture
Dr. Steven Wong completed his acupuncture training at Grant MacEwan University, graduating in 2025. He is a Doctor of Acupuncture with the College of Acupuncturists of Alberta, supporting the Edmonton area. He has experience practicing in both multidisciplinary settings and private practice, working with a wide range of patient needs.
Prior to his career in acupuncture, Steven worked as a Biomedical Engineering Technician for over a decade. During the COVID-19 pandemic he developed, set up, and maintained critical laboratory equipment under high-pressure conditions. This experience cultivated a strong attention to detail, adaptability, and a deep sense of responsibility, while also providing firsthand insight into the impact of chronic stress and burnout.
His clinical approach is grounded in Traditional Chinese Medicine and informed by a modern, evidence-aware perspective. His acupuncture practice focuses on restoring balance through regulation of the nervous system and addressing underlying patterns that contribute to pain and dysfunction. Treatments are tailored to each individual, with an emphasis on both immediate relief and longer-term outcomes.
Dr. Steven Wong is trained in trauma-informed care and integrates this into all aspects of treatment, prioritizing patient safety, consent, and adaptability. Within Wayfound, he offers Ear Acupuncture Resilience (EAR) treatments to support stress response, emotional regulation, and recovery from the effects of trauma and burnout.
Dr. Steven Wong aims to create a space where patients feel supported, informed, and actively engaged in their care.
